首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

CSS/HTML菜单-无法关闭iOS上的菜单

CSS/HTML菜单是一种用于网页设计的技术,用于创建网页上的导航菜单。在iOS设备上,有时会遇到无法关闭菜单的问题。这可能是由于以下原因导致的:

  1. CSS样式问题:检查菜单的CSS样式是否正确设置。确保菜单的显示属性设置为"none",并且在需要显示菜单的事件中将其更改为"block"或"flex"。
  2. JavaScript事件问题:如果菜单使用JavaScript来控制显示和隐藏,确保事件绑定和处理函数正确。检查事件是否正确触发,并且处理函数中的逻辑是否正确关闭菜单。
  3. iOS触摸事件问题:iOS设备上的触摸事件与桌面设备上的鼠标事件略有不同。确保菜单的触摸事件处理逻辑正确,以便在用户点击菜单外部区域时关闭菜单。
  4. 兼容性问题:不同版本的iOS可能存在兼容性问题。确保菜单的代码在不同版本的iOS设备上都能正常工作。可以使用浏览器的开发者工具模拟不同的iOS设备进行测试。

对于解决无法关闭iOS上的菜单问题,可以尝试以下方法:

  1. 检查CSS样式:确保菜单的CSS样式正确设置,并且在需要关闭菜单的事件中将其隐藏。
  2. 检查JavaScript事件:如果使用JavaScript控制菜单的显示和隐藏,确保事件绑定和处理函数正确,并且在需要关闭菜单的事件中执行关闭逻辑。
  3. 检查触摸事件:确保菜单的触摸事件处理逻辑正确,以便在用户点击菜单外部区域时关闭菜单。
  4. 测试兼容性:在不同版本的iOS设备上测试菜单的功能,确保在各种情况下都能正常关闭菜单。

腾讯云相关产品和产品介绍链接地址:

腾讯云提供了丰富的云计算产品和服务,包括云服务器、云数据库、云存储等。您可以访问腾讯云官方网站了解更多详情:https://cloud.tencent.com/

请注意,以上答案仅供参考,具体解决方案可能因具体情况而异。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券